UPSSSC PET 2026 Syllabus: The Uttar Pradesh Subordinate Service Selection Commission (UPSSSC) will release the UPSSSC PET 2026 Syllabus along with the notification in the form of information brochure on the official website at upsssc.gov.in. Candidates who want to appear for the exam must know about the syllabus, types of questions asked, number of questions, marking scheme and pattern of an exam. In total, 100 questions will be asked in the examination. Each question carries one mark and one fourth negative marking for every incorrect answer. The UPSSSC PET exam will be conducted as an eligibility test for the recruitment of Group C posts. 

UP PET Syllabus is prescribed by the Uttar Pradesh Subordinate Services Selection Commission (UPSSSC). It will be released in the form of PDF.  Here we have shared the detailed syllabus of the UPSSSC PET 2026 exam.

UPSSSC PET Syllabus 2026: Overview

The UP PET Syllabus consists of the subject-wise topics from which the questions will be asked in the examination. Therefore, candidates should know about the syllabus and exam pattern to prepare a strategy for the examination. Given below is the overview of the UPSSSC PET Syllabus 2026.

Exam Particulars Exam Details
Mode of exam Offline
Conducting Authority Uttar Pradesh Subordinate Services Selection Commission
Nature of questions 100 Questions (Objective-type)
Total Marks 100

Exam Duration

120 Minutes (2 Hours)

Language of question paper English and Hindi

Post Name/Purpose of the exam

For recruitment of Group C positions

Negative Marking

0.25 Marks will be deducted for every incorrect answer

UPSSSC PET Syllabus 2026: Subject-wise

The duration of the exam is two hours. Candidates will come to know about the important topics, subject-wise weightage of marks, etc. Scroll down to check below the subject-wise syllabus for the UPSSSC PET exam. 

Subject Questions Marks

Indian History

  1. Indus valley civilization
  2. Vedic civilization
  3. Buddhism
  4. Jainism
  5. Mauryan empire
  6. Gupta empire
  7. Harshavardhan
  8. Rajput era
  9. Sultanate era
  10. Mughal empire
  11. Maratha empire
  12. British Rule and 1st war of independence
  13. Social and economic impact of British rule
5 5

Indian National Movement

  1. Initial stage of freedom movement
  2. Swadeshi and civil disobedience movement - Mahatma Gandhi and other leaders’ role
  3. Revolutionary movement and rise of militant nationalism
  4. Farewell Amendment and British India Act 1935
  5. Quit India movement, Azad Hind Fauj and Netaji Subhash Chandra Bose
5 5

Geography (Indian & World)

  1. Rivers
  2. Water resources
  3. Mountains & glaciers
  4. Desert & dry areas
  5. Forest
  6. Mineral resources
    • Political Geography of India & World
    • Climate
    • Time zone
    • Demographics & migrations
5 5

Indian Economy (1947 to 1991)

  1. Planning commission and 5-year plans
  2. Development of mixed economy: Private & Public
  3. Green revolution
  4. White revolution & operation flood
  5. Banking nationalization
    • LPG reforms of 1991
    • Economic reforms post-2014
  1. Farm reforms
  2. Structural reforms
  3. Labour reforms
  4. Economic reforms
  5. GST
5 5

Indian Constitution & Public Administration

  1. Salient Features
  2. Directive principles
  3. Fundamental rights & duties
  4. Parliamentary system
  5. Federal system, Union Govt & UR, Union Govt & States
  6. Judicial Framework
    • District Administration
    • Local bodies and Panchayat Raj
5 5

General Science

  1. Basic Physics
  2. Basic Chemistry
  3. Basic Biology
5 5

Elementary Arithmetic

  1. Whole numbers, fractions and decimals
  2. Percentage
  3. Simple arithmetic equations
  4. Square & square roots
  5. Exponent and powers
  6. Average
5 5

General Hindi

  1. संधि
  2. विलोम शब्द
  3. पर्यायवाची वाक्यांशों के लिए एक शब्द
  4. लिंग
  5. समश्रुतभिन्नार्थक शब्द
  6. मुहावरे-लोकोक्तियां
  7. सामान्य अशुद्धियां
  8. लेखक और रचनाएं 
5 5

General English

  1. English Grammar
  2. Questions on passages
5 5

Logic & Reasoning

  1. Order & ranking
  2. Blood relations
  3. Calendar & watch
  4. Cause & effect
  5. Coding decoding
  6. Conclusive reasoning, etc.
5 5

 Current Affairs

  1. National current affairs
  2. International current affairs
10 10

General Awareness

  1. India's Neighbours
  2. Countries, Capitals & Currencies
  3. Indian States & UTs
  4. Indian Parliament
  5. Days of National & International Importance
  6. World organizations & HQs
  7. Indian tourism destinations
  8. Indian art & culture
  9. Indian & International Sports
  10. Indian research institutes
  11. Books & Authors
  12. Awards & Honours
  13. Climate change & environment
10 10
Analysis of Hindi Unread Passage - 2 Passages 10 10
Graph Interpretation - 2 Graphs 10 10
Table Interpretation & Analysis - 2 Tables 10 10
Total 100 100

UPSSSC PET Exam Pattern 2026

In the UP PET exam 100 questions are asked in the examination. The time duration is two hours. 0.25 marks will be deducted for every wrong answer. The exam consists of objective type questions. Candidates can read the UPSSSC PET Exam Pattern below in this article.

  • The UPSSSC PET 2026 exam will be conducted in an offline mode.
  • Total Questions asked: 100 Questions
  • Marks: 100 Marks
  • Time Duration: 2 hours
  • Correct Answer: 1 mark will be awarded for each correct answer
  • Negative Marking: 1/4th mark will be deducted for each wrong answer

UP PET Syllabus 2026 in Hindi (PDF Download)

The UPSSSC PET Syllabus is divided in to several sections and test candidates' general aptitude and awareness. The subject-wise syllabus is provided below in Hindi language. Scroll down to read the UPSSSC PET Syllabus 2026 in Hindi.

विषय पाठ्‌य-विवरण
भारतीय इतिहास (Indian History) सिन्धु घाटी की सम्भता वैदिक संस्कृति बौद्ध धर्म: गौतम बुद्ध(जीवनी एवं शिक्षायें) जैन धर्म : महावीर (जीवनी एवं शिक्षायें) मौर्य वंश : सम्राट अशोक गुप्त वंश : समुद्र गुप्त ,चन्द्र गुप्त द्वितीय हर्षवर्द्धन राजपूत काल सल्तनत काल मुगल साम्राज्य मराठा ब्रिटिश राज का अभ्युदय एवं प्रथम स्वतंत्रता संग्राम ब्रिटिश राज का मामाजिक-आर्थिक प्रभाव
भारतीय राष्ट्रीय आन्दोलन (Indian National Movement) स्वाधीनता आन्दोलन के प्रारम्भिक वर्ष स्वदेशी तथा सविनय अवज्ञा आंदोलन : महात्मा गाँधी तथा अन्य नेताओं की भूमिका क्रांतिकारी आंदोलन तथा उग्र राष्ट्रवाद का उदयविधायी संशोधन तथा ब्रिटिश इंडिया एक्ट, 1935 भारत छोड़ो आंदोलन, आजाद हिन्द फौज तथा नेता जी सुभाष चन्द्र बोस
भूगोल (Geography) भारत एवं विश्व का भौतिक भूगोल नदियां नथा नदियों की घाटी भूजल संसाधन पर्वत ,पहाडियां तथा हिमनद मरूस्थल और शुष्क क्षेत्र वन खनिज संसाधन (विशेषकर भारत में) भारत एवं विश्व का राजनैतिक भूगोल जलवायु तथा मौसम टाइम जोन जनसांख्यकीय परिवर्तन तथा प्रवास
भारतीय अर्थव्यवस्था (Indian Economy) भारतीय अर्थव्यवस्था (1947 से 1991 तक) योजना आयोग तथा पंचवर्षीय योजनायें मिथित अर्थव्यवस्था का विकास: निजी एवं सार्वजनिक क्षेत्र हरित क्राति दुग्ध विकास एवं ऑपरेशन फ्लड बैंकों का राष्ट्रीयकरण तथा सुधार वर्ष 1991 में आर्थिक सुधार तथा उसके बाद की अर्थव्यवस्था वर्ष 2014 के पश्चात के आर्थिक सुधार कृषि सुधार ढांचागत सुधार श्रम-सुधार आर्थिक सुधार जी0एम0टी0
भारतीय संविधान एवं लोक प्रशासन (Indian Constitution & Public Administration) भारतीय संविधान भारतीय संविधान की मुख्य विशेषतायें राज्य के नीति-निर्देशक सिद्धान्त मौलिक अधिकार एवं कर्तव्य संसदीय प्रणाली संघीय प्रणाली, संघ एवं केन्द्रशासित प्रदेश, केन्द्र-राज्या सम्बन्ध न्यायिक ढांचा-मर्वोच्च न्यायालय, उच्च न्यायालय जिला प्रशासन . स्थानीय निकाय तथा पंचायती राज संस्थायें
सामान्य विज्ञान (General Science) प्रारम्भिक भौतिक विज्ञान प्रारम्भिक रसायन विज्ञा प्रारम्भिक जीव विज्ञान
प्रारम्भिक अंकगणित (Elementary Arithmetic) पूर्ण संख्या, भिन्न तथा दशमलव प्रतिशतता साधारण अंकगणितीय समीकरण वर्ग एवं वर्गमूल घातांक एवं घात औसत
सामान्य हिन्दी (General Hindi) संधि विलोम शब्द पर्यायवाची शब्द वाक्यांशो के लिए एक शब्द लिंग समथुत भिन्नार्थक शब्द मुहावरे-लोकोक्तियाँ सामान्य अशुद्धियां लेखक और रचनाएँ (गद्य एवं पद्य)
सामान्य अंग्रेजी (General English) अंग्रेजी व्याकरण अपठित गद्यांश पर आधारित प्रश्न
तर्क एवं तर्कशक्ति (Logic & Reasoning) वृहत एवं लघु क्रम एवं रैंकिग संबंध समूह से भिन्न को अलग करना कैलेण्डर एवं घड़ी कारण और प्रभाव कोडिंग-डिकोडिंग (संख्या तथा अक्षर) निगमनात्मक तर्क/कथन विश्लेषण एवं निर्णय
सामयिकी (Current Affairs) भारतीय एवं वैश्विक
सामान्य जागरूकता (General Awareness) भारत के पड़ोसी देश देश, राजधानी एवं मुद्रा भारत के राज्य तथा केन्द्र शासित प्रदेश भारतीय संसद, राज्यसभा, लोकसभा और विधान सभा, विधान परिपद राष्ट्रीय एवं अन्तर्राष्ट्रीय दिवस विश्व संगठन एवं उनके मुख्यालय भारतीय पर्यटन स्थल भारत की कला एवं संस्कृति भारत एवं विश्व के खेल भारतीय अनुसंधान संगठन प्रसिद्ध पुस्तकें और लेखक पुरस्कार एवं बिजेता जलवायु परिवर्तन एवं पर्यावरण
अपठित हिंदी गद्यांश का विवेचन एवं विश्लेषण अपठित हिंदी गद्यांश का विवेचन एवं विश्लेषण – 02 गद्यांश प्रत्येक पर 5 प्रश्न
ग्राफ की व्याख्या एवं विश्लेषण ग्राफ की व्याख्या एवं विश्लेषण – 02 ग्राफ प्रत्येक पर 5 प्रश्न
तालिका की व्याख्या एवं विश्लेषण तालिका की व्याख्या एवं विश्लेषण – 02 तालिकाएँ प्रत्येक पर 5 प्रश्न

Q:   Is there a biometric verification process before the UPSSSC PET exam?
A: 

Yes, there is a biometric attendance and document verification process usually conducted at the examination centre before the UPSSSC PET exam starts. Therefore, reaching on time is crucial. Also, the admit card is important to be carried along with the candidate otherwise they will not be allowed to take the exam.

Q:   What is the eligibility criteria for the UPSSSC PET exam?
A: 

Candidates with the minimum academic qualification of Class Xth or equivalent and between the age limit 18 years to 40 years can apply for UPSSSC PET exam. The login page will be provided on the UPSSSC official website.
